Blade And Lube Limited

About Blade And Lube Limited

Social Link - Linkedin: http://www. linkedin.com/company /blade-and-lube-limited
Keywords: chemicals

More about Blade And Lube Limited

Blade And Lube Limited is located at Glasgow, Scotland, United Kingdom